Glomerular immune deposits in murine lupus models may contain histones

Two types of lupus mice, NZB/NZW F1 female hybrids and mice with graft-versus-host disease (GVHD), were studied. Histones H3 and H2A were detected by immunofluorescence in glomeruli of 22/22 proteinuric GVHD and 8/12 proteinuric NZB/W F1 female mice; in non-proteinuric animals, 3/5 GVHD and 2/27 NZB/W F1 female were positive. Using antibodies to histone peptides it was shown that mainly the N-terminal regions of histones H3 and H2A were exposed in glomerular deposits. Western blot analysis revealed antibodies to histone subfractions in sera of 33/34 lupus mice that developed proteinuria. This study provides evidence that histones are involved in the pathogenesis of lupus nephritis.
